Under-Seat Carry-on Luggage Comparison
| Product | Dimensions (H x W x D) | Weight | Laptop Size (Max) | USB Charging Port | Warranty | Key Features |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Lifeamar 16-inch Softside Spinner Suitcase | 18″x14″x8″ | 4.45 lbs | 15″ | No | Not Specified | Executive-Grade Storage, TSA Turbo Mode, Silent Wheels |
| Samsonite Underseat Carry-On Spinner | 16.5″x13.75″x9″ | 7.0 lbs | 13.3″ | Yes | Limited 3 Year | Smart Sleeve, Multi-directional Wheels, Quick Stash Pockets |
| Taygeer Carry on Backpack | 16.8″x11″x7″ | 0.79 kg (1.74 lb) | 15.6″ | Yes (External) | Not Specified | Multi-Compartment, Backpack/Duffle Hybrid, Airport-Friendly Design |
| Amazon Basics Underseat Carry On Luggage | 13.4″x14.2″x9.5″ | Not Specified | Not Specified | No | Not Specified | Compact & Versatile, Organized Interior, Easy Maneuverability |
| LUGGEX Underseat Carry On Luggage | 15.7″x13″x7.7″ | Not Specified | 15.6″ | No | 3-Year Protection Plan | Versatile, Sturdy Aluminum Handle, Smart Sleeve |
| BAGSMART Small Underseat Carry on Luggage | 17.5″x13.7″x7.8″ | Not Specified | 15.6″ | No | Not Specified | Organized Storage, Hassle-free Travel, Durable Fabric |
| FIGESTIN Underseat Carry On Luggage | 17″x13.3″x8.5″ | 4.78 lbs | 15.6″ | No | 2-Year Warranty | Secure Design (Lockable Zippers), Ergonomic Handle, Water-Resistant |
| MIAOJIE Lightweight Travel Tote Duffle Bag | 16″x8″x11″ | Not Specified | 12″ | No | Not Specified | Lightweight, Multi-Pocket, Versatile (Tote/Duffle) |
| Wrangler 17″ Underseat Spinner Luggage | Not Specified | Not Specified | Not Specified | Yes (Side) | Not Specified | USB Charging Port, Compact, Effortless Mobility |

Choosing the Right Under-Seat Carry-On Luggage
Size and Airline Compatibility
The primary benefit of under-seat luggage is avoiding checked baggage fees and having essentials readily accessible. However, dimensions are critical. Airlines have varying size restrictions, so always check your airline’s specific requirements before you buy. Most airlines allow a personal item with dimensions around 18 x 14 x 8 inches, but it’s best to confirm. A bag that’s even slightly too large can result in gate-checking, defeating the purpose. Look for luggage specifically marketed as “airline-approved” and verify those dimensions against your chosen carrier.
Storage Capacity & Organization
Under-seat bags are smaller, so maximizing space and organization is key. Consider your travel style. Do you primarily need space for electronics and a book, or do you want to pack a change of clothes?
- Compartments: Multiple compartments are a huge benefit. Look for bags with dedicated laptop sleeves (ensuring they fit your laptop size), zippered pockets for toiletries or valuables, and compression straps to secure clothing.
- Front Pockets: Easily accessible front pockets are great for quick-access items like boarding passes, phones, or snacks.
- Main Compartment: The size of the main compartment dictates how much clothing you can realistically bring.
Wheel Quality & Maneuverability
Navigating busy airports requires luggage that rolls smoothly.
- Spinner Wheels: Four spinner wheels (360-degree rotation) offer superior maneuverability, allowing you to push the bag alongside you rather than pulling it. This reduces strain on your shoulder and back.
- Wheel Material: Look for durable wheels made from high-quality materials. Cheaper wheels can wear down quickly, making your travel experience frustrating.
- Handle: An adjustable, telescoping handle is essential for comfortable use. Consider the handle height range to ensure it suits your stature.
Material and Durability
The material impacts both the weight and the longevity of your bag.
- Polyester: A common, affordable option that’s relatively lightweight and water-resistant.
- Nylon: More durable than polyester, offering better abrasion resistance.
- Softside vs. Hardside: Softside bags are generally lighter and more flexible, allowing you to squeeze them into tighter spaces. Hardside bags offer greater protection for fragile items.
Additional Features
- USB Charging Port: Convenient for keeping your devices powered up on the go (requires a separate power bank).
- Luggage Strap: Allows you to attach the bag to the handle of a larger suitcase for easier transport.
- Water Resistance: Helpful for protecting your belongings from unexpected spills or rain.
- Lockable Zippers: Provide added security for your valuables.
